Understanding Live Roulette
Before diving into the strategies and tips for success, it’s essential to understand the basics of live roulette. The game is played on a wheel with numbered pockets, alternating between red and black colors, with a green pocket representing the zero (or double zero in American roulette). Players place their bets on either specific numbers, groups of numbers, or colors. Once all bets are placed, the dealer spins the wheel and drops a ball into it. The winning number is determined by where the ball lands.
The Different Variants of Live Roulette
Live roulette is available in several variants, with the most common being European Roulette, American Roulette, and French Roulette.
- European Roulette: Features a single zero (0), making the house edge 2.7%. This variant is preferred by many players due to its lower house edge and payout rules.
- American Roulette: Includes both a single zero (0) and a double zero (00), leading to a higher house edge of approximately 5.26%. Despite the increased risk, some players enjoy this variant for its unique betting options.
- French Roulette: Similar to European Roulette but with additional rules and betting options like “La Partage” and “En Prison,” which provide more favorable odds to players.

Strategies for Winning at Live Roulette
While roulette is primarily a game of chance, there are strategies you can employ to enhance your odds of winning. Here are some popular strategies among experienced players:
- The Martingale System: This betting system involves doubling your bet after every loss, with the idea that a win will eventually cover previous losses and yield a profit. However, players should be cautious as this requires a substantial bankroll and can lead to significant losses.
- The Fibonacci Strategy: This system is based on the famous Fibonacci sequence (1, 1, 2, 3, 5, 8, 13, etc.). In this strategy, players increase their bets according to this sequence following a loss, with the aim of recovering losses with fewer total wins.
- The D’Alembert System: A less aggressive approach, this method involves increasing your bet by one unit after a loss and decreasing it by one unit after a win, aiming for a balanced outcome over time.
